Chairman of the Prime Minister's Youth Programme Rana Mashhood Ahmad Khan on Wednesday reaffirmed Pakistan's political, diplomatic and moral support for the people of Indian Illegally Occupied Jammu and Kashmir, marking Youm-e-Istehsal-e-Kashmir. In a message issued on the occasion, he said August 5 symbolizes solidarity with the Kashmiri people against India's August 5, 2019 actions, urged the international community to play its role in resolving the Kashmir dispute in accordance with United Nations Security Council resolutions, and reiterated Pakistan's commitment to supporting the Kashmiri people's right to self determination.

Rana Mashhood Ahmad Khan said India's decision to revoke the special constitutional status of Jammu and Kashmir on August 5, 2019 violated United Nations resolutions and international law. He said the Kashmiri people's struggle is a just movement for justice, peace and fundamental human rights. Expressing concern over the situation in the occupied territory, he said reports of human rights violations, restrictions on freedom of expression and curbs on civil liberties continued to raise serious concerns. He said measures introduced after August 5, 2019 had created concerns over changes to the demographic and political character of Indian Illegally Occupied Jammu and Kashmir.

He added that the issuance of domicile certificates to non Kashmiris had raised apprehensions regarding the rights, identity and political representation of the indigenous population. Referring to reports that millions of domicile certificates had been issued in the occupied territory, Rana Mashhood Ahmad Khan said such developments had intensified concerns about preserving the identity and democratic rights of the local population. He urged the international community to take immediate notice of the situation in Indian Illegally Occupied Jammu and Kashmir and contribute to a just.

peaceful and lasting resolution of the Kashmir dispute in accordance with the relevant United Nations Security Council resolutions and the aspirations of the Kashmiri people. Rana Mashhood Ahmad Khan said Pakistan would continue extending political, diplomatic and moral support to the people of Jammu and Kashmir. He added that August 5 serves as a reminder to renew solidarity with the Kashmiri people and reaffirm support for their right to self determination. He said Pakistan would continue to stand with its brothers and sisters in Indian Illegally Occupied Jammu and Kashmir and raise their cause at every international forum until a peaceful resolution of the dispute is achieved.
